上一页 1 ··· 112 113 114 115 116 117 118 119 120 ··· 123 下一页
摘要: 摘自http://blog.csdn.net/guosha/article/details/2679334 实际用户ID,有效用户ID和设置用户ID 看UNIX相关的书时经常能遇到这几个概念,但一直没有好好去理清这几个概念,以致对这几个概念一直一知半解。今天好好区分了一下这几个概念并总结如下。说白了 阅读全文
posted @ 2016-06-02 16:47 LiuYanYGZ 阅读(785) 评论(0) 推荐(0) 编辑
摘要: 摘自http://blog.chinaunix.net/uid-23069658-id-3142046.html 今天我们主要来说说Linux系统下基于动态库(.so)和静态(.a)的程序那些猫腻。在这之前,我们需要了解一下源代码到可执行程序之间到底发生了什么神奇而美妙的事情。 在Linux操作系统 阅读全文
posted @ 2016-06-02 00:54 LiuYanYGZ 阅读(482) 评论(0) 推荐(0) 编辑
摘要: 摘自http://www.tuicool.com/articles/EvIzUn gcc选项-g与-rdynamic的异同 gcc 的 -g ,应该没有人不知道它是一个调试选项,因此在一般需要进行程序调试的场景下,我们都会加上该选项,并且根据调试工具的不同,还能直接选择更有针对性的说明,比如 -gg 阅读全文
posted @ 2016-06-01 18:08 LiuYanYGZ 阅读(27476) 评论(0) 推荐(2) 编辑
摘要: 摘自http://blog.csdn.net/saga1979/article/details/14161229 man ld.so(8)说,如果库依赖不包括“/”,那么它将按照下面的规则按顺序搜索: (仅对ELF格式)如果可执行文件包含DT_RPATH标签,并且不包含DT_RUNPATH标签,将从 阅读全文
posted @ 2016-06-01 11:23 LiuYanYGZ 阅读(879) 评论(0) 推荐(0) 编辑
摘要: RPATH与RUNPATH 时间 2011-11-01 21:46:44 Qt Labs China 原文 http://labs.qt.nokia.com.cn/2011/11/01/rpath-and-runpath/ 主题 Qt 原文链接: ckamm - RPATH and RUNPATH 阅读全文
posted @ 2016-06-01 11:21 LiuYanYGZ 阅读(3539) 评论(0) 推荐(0) 编辑
摘要: 摘自http://blog.csdn.net/liuchao1986105/article/details/6674822 版本] -0.13 [声明] 这篇文档是我的关于gcc参数的笔记,我很怀念dos年代我用小本子,纪录任何的dos 命令的参数.哈哈,下面的东西可能也不是很全面,我参考了很多的书 阅读全文
posted @ 2016-06-01 10:56 LiuYanYGZ 阅读(42668) 评论(0) 推荐(4) 编辑
摘要: 摘自http://www.cnblogs.com/Anker/p/3746802.html 采用dlopen、dlsym、dlclose加载动态链接库【总结】 1、前言 为了使程序方便扩展,具备通用性,可以采用插件形式。采用异步事件驱动模型,保证主程序逻辑不变,将各个业务已动态链接库的形式加载进来, 阅读全文
posted @ 2016-06-01 01:07 LiuYanYGZ 阅读(466) 评论(0) 推荐(0) 编辑
摘要: http://www.ibm.com/developerworks/cn/linux/l-cn-linklib/ 技巧:Linux 动态库与静态库制作及使用详解 标准库的三种连接方式及静态库制作与使用方法 Linux 应用开发通常要考虑三个问题,即:1)在 Linux 应用程序开发过程中遇到过标准库 阅读全文
posted @ 2016-05-31 18:19 LiuYanYGZ 阅读(593) 评论(0) 推荐(0) 编辑
摘要: 摘自http://gotowqj.iteye.com/blog/1926771 linux动态库加载RPATH, RUNPATH 链接动态库 如何程序在连接时使用了共享库,就必须在运行的时候能够找到共享库的位置。linux的可执行程序在执行的时候默认是先搜索/lib和/usr/lib这两个目录,然后 阅读全文
posted @ 2016-05-31 16:13 LiuYanYGZ 阅读(3877) 评论(0) 推荐(0) 编辑
摘要: 摘自http://gotowqj.iteye.com/blog/1926613 对动态库的实际应用还不太熟悉的读者可能曾经遇到过类似“error while loading shared libraries”这样的错误,这是典型的因为需要的动态库不在动态链接器ld.so的搜索路径设置当中导致的。 具 阅读全文
posted @ 2016-05-31 16:10 LiuYanYGZ 阅读(454) 评论(0) 推荐(0) 编辑
上一页 1 ··· 112 113 114 115 116 117 118 119 120 ··· 123 下一页